The verdict

2253-B2229 runs at 200%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Home Health Care Services workplace, earning a grade F.

2253-B2229 injury rate improved

2253-B2229's TCR fell 0.7 from 10.8 in 2016 to 10.1 in 2017. Peak filing year was 2016 at 10.8 TCR. In 2017, DART was 0.6×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Data Source: OSHA Injury Tracking Application (ITA), mandatory establishment-level injury/illness reports. Grades compare employer Total Case Rate (TCR) to BLS IIF industry benchmarks. Data covers years reported by this establishment: 2017, 2016. This is publicly available government data - not a legal determination of workplace conditions.
